How they compare
Mozambique currently reports 12.6% against 9.6% in Lower middle income, a difference of 3.0%.
That makes Mozambique's figure about 1.3 times Lower middle income's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Lower middle income ahead.
Lower middle income ranks 18th and Mozambique ranks 17th of 47 groups.
Across the 7 decades both report, Lower middle income averaged higher in 3 and Mozambique in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lower middle income | Mozambique |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 11.5% | 10.2% | 1.3% | Lower middle income |
| 1970s | 12.0% | 11.0% | 1.0% | Lower middle income |
| 1980s | 11.7% | 11.5% | 0.2% | Lower middle income |
| 1990s | 11.8% | 12.3% | 0.5% | Mozambique |
| 2000s | 11.2% | 12.4% | 1.2% | Mozambique |
| 2010s | 10.4% | 12.4% | 2.0% | Mozambique |
| 2020s | 9.8% | 12.6% | 2.7% | Mozambique |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
